Output 9523b55560981d36b6f11f0cc1397e207acf3e111e18985699b2f66b21f81059:2

value
634283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16ebf280d32a63231f1fbc25fb302412a14d9756 OP_EQUALVERIFY OP_CHECKSIG
address
136CX8E2tsw76o1h9pisB9p7rtiK87X58C
transaction
9523b55560981d36b6f11f0cc1397e207acf3e111e18985699b2f66b21f81059
spent
true